Egress window installation involves creating a compliant and functional exit point from a basement or lower-level living space. This process typically includes cutting into the foundation wall, installing a properly sized window well, and ensuring the opening meets safety and building code requirements. The goal is to provide a safe escape route in case of emergencies, while also allowing natural light and ventilation into the lower levels of a property. Professional contractors assess the existing structure and determine the appropriate location and size for the egress window, ensuring it integrates seamlessly with the property's foundation.
This service addresses several common issues associated with basement spaces, such as limited emergency exits, poor natural lighting, and inadequate ventilation. Without a proper egress window, basement rooms may not meet safety standards, potentially complicating insurance or resale processes. Installing an egress window can improve safety by providing a clear escape route during emergencies like fires or floods. Additionally, the increased natural light and airflow can make basement living areas more comfortable and inviting, transforming them into usable, functional spaces.

Material and Window Type - Costs for egress window installation typically range from $2,000 to $5,000, depending on the window style and materials chosen. For example, a standard vinyl egress window may cost around $2,500, while custom or larger windows can exceed $4,500.
Foundation and Excavation - Excavation and foundation work for egress windows usually add $1,000 to $3,000 to the project cost. The price varies based on the depth of the window well and the complexity of the excavation needed in Broadview Heights, OH.
Labor and Permits - Labor costs for installing an egress window generally range from $1,000 to $2,500, depending on the project's scope. Permit fees, if required, can range from $50 to $300, varying by local regulations.
Additional Features and Customizations - Adding features like window wells, covers, or custom framing can increase total costs by $500 to $1,500. These extras depend on specific homeowner preferences and site conditions in the local area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
